THIS PROPOSAL DIRECTLY ADDRESSES THE PRIORITIES OF THE EXPLORATORY RESEARCH PROGRAM BY PROVIDING TOOLS NECESSARY TO ALLOW THE UTILIZATION OF INDUSTRIAL HEMP (IH) IN LIVESTOCK PRODUCTION SYSTEMS. THE 2014 FARM BILL LEGALIZED THE CULTIVATION AND PRODUCTION OF IH (CANNABIS SATIVA CONTAINING < 0.3%TETRAHYDROCANNABINOL (THC)). THE REMOVAL OF IH AS DEA SCHEDULE I DRUG IN THE 2018 FARM BILL HAS GENERATED INTEREST IN HEMP CULTIVATION AS A NOVEL AGRICULTURAL COMMODITY. HEMP PLANTS, AND THEIR BY-PRODUCTS, ARE CONSIDERED TO HAVE NUTRITIONAL AND POTENTIALLY THERAPEUTIC VALUE WHEN USED AS A FEED SOURCE IN LIVESTOCK. HOWEVER, THE PRESENCE OF BIOACTIVE CANNABINOID COMPOUNDS IN HEMP MAY RESULT IN DRUG RESIDUES THAT COULD POSE A RISK TO THE CONSUMER. THE ABSENCE OF PUBLISHED DATA DESCRIBING THE PHARMACOKINETICS, TISSUE AND MILK RESIDUE DEPLETION OF CANNABINOIDS IN CATTLE IS A SIGNIFICANT IMPEDIMENT TO FUTURE ANIMAL HEALTH AND PRODUCTION RESEARCH WITH IH. THIS PROPOSAL WILL DIRECTLY ADDRESS THIS DEFICIENTLY BY (1) DEVELOPING NOVEL ANALYTICAL TOOLS TO QUANTIFY CANNABINOID CONCENTRATIONS IN HEMP PLANT MATERIALS AND IN THE BLOOD, MILK AND EDIBLE TISSUES OF CATTLE EXPOSED TO HEMP AND (2) CHARACTERIZING THE PLASMA PHARMACOKINETICS (PK) AND MILK AND EDIBLE TISSUE RESIDUE DEPLETION PROFILES OF CANNABINOIDS AND THEIR METABOLITES IN CATTLE AFTER ORAL EXPOSURE TO IH. SUCCESSFUL COMPLETION OF THESE SPECIFIC AIMS WILL DELIVER NEW KNOWLEDGE THAT WILL FULFILL THE MANDATE OF THE FARM BILL. THE OUTCOMES OF THIS PROJECT ARE URGENTLY NEEDED IN ORDER FOR THE VALUE OF HEMP PRODUCTS IN U.S. LIVESTOCK PRODUCTION SYSTEMS TO BE INVESTIGATED.
